## Onboarding: StockTally Reconciliation Job

Hi! As release manager at Fernbeck Retail, you'll own the nightly StockTally inventory reconciliation job. It compares warehouse counts against the ledger and files discrepancy reports before the morning sync. Most weeks it just hums along. If a release breaks the job mid-run, you can roll back to the last good snapshot from the ops console — but the snapshot vault is sealed. To unseal it, enter the recovery passphrase shown below.

vault phrase of kawef-yahop = wenir-jorox-druys-belion-kelion-lamvan-frawyn-norael-julox-raleth-rusax-oliys-holael

Autocomplete widget (Placefinder v3) degrades silently when the suggestion cache goes stale. Symptoms: empty dropdowns, no errors in client logs. Check the cache warmer job first; it runs hourly on the Kestrel cluster. If the warmer is healthy, verify the geocode upstream quota — Placefinder throttles itself and returns empty arrays rather than 429s. Do not restart the widget service; it rebuilds its index on boot and takes twenty minutes. Full escalation tree and cache-flush procedure are documented on the internal page below.

dashboard of hadug-fawep = https://artifactory.braskhq.test/deploy

// REINDEX_BATCH_CAP limits docs per shard pass in the Tallowfield
// nightly search reindex. Raising it starves the ingest queue;
// lowering it overruns the maintenance window. 5000 is the tested
// sweet spot. Change only with a soak run. Verified against the
// build noted below.

session token of bawif-hahog = htk6_ac5981